मुझे भी PyMySQL पर स्विच करना पड़ा। मैं पाइप 1.5.6, पायथन 2.7.8 चला रहा हूं, और mysql-connector 2.0.1 की कोशिश की
मैं बिना किसी समस्या के सीक्वल प्रो के भीतर से क्वेरी को चलाने में सक्षम था, लेकिन परिणामों का एक सबसेट वापस करने के बाद प्रश्न में वर्णित त्रुटि के साथ मेरी पायथन क्वेरी विफल हो जाएगी।
PyMySQL पर स्विच किया गया और चीजें अपेक्षा के अनुरूप काम करती हैं।
https://github.com/PyMySQL/PyMySQL
वर्चुअलएन्व में:
pip install pymysql
कोड में:
import pymysql
connection = pymysql.connect(user='x', passwd='x',
host='x',
database='x')
cursor = connection.cursor()
query = ("MYQUERY")
cursor.execute(query)
for item in cursor:
print item
निश्चित रूप से mysql-कनेक्टर-पायथन में एक बग।